โ€ข Introduction to Urban Foodscaping: Understanding the concept, benefits, and principles of urban foodscaping.
โ€ข Site Analysis for Urban Foodscaping: Assessing site conditions, resources, and limitations for successful foodscaping.
โ€ข Plant Selection and Design: Choosing appropriate plants and designing efficient urban foodscapes.
โ€ข Soil Management and Composting: Improving soil health, fertility, and water retention through sustainable practices.
โ€ข Integrated Pest Management: Managing pests and diseases using ecological methods.
โ€ข Water-efficient Irrigation: Designing and implementing water-efficient irrigation systems for urban foodscapes.
โ€ข Seasonal Extension Techniques: Extending the growing season through various techniques, such as hoop houses and cold frames.
โ€ข Community Engagement and Education: Promoting urban foodscaping through outreach, education, and collaborative projects.
โ€ข Policy and Advocacy: Understanding urban foodscaping policies and advocating for change at the local level.

In the UK, there's a growing demand for professionals in the urban foodscaping strategies sector. This section showcases a 3D pie chart that highlights the most in-demand roles and their respective market shares. 1. Urban Planners (35%): These professionals focus on designing and optimising urban spaces to accommodate food production. They create sustainable and resilient cities by integrating food systems into the urban fabric. 2. Landscape Architects (25%): Landscape architects design and build functional green spaces in urban areas. They address food access and security issues by incorporating edible landscapes and community gardens into their projects. 3. Agricultural Engineers (20%): With expertise in crop production and farming systems, agricultural engineers help design and implement innovative urban agriculture solutions, such as vertical farming and hydroponics. 4. Sustainability Consultants (15%): Sustainability consultants help businesses and organisations reduce their environmental footprint and improve social outcomes. In the context of urban foodscaping, they advise on sustainable food production methods and waste reduction strategies. 5. Horticulturists (5%): Horticulturists specialise in the cultivation of plants, often in urban settings. They may work in community gardens, urban farms, or parks, maintaining edible landscapes and educating the public about plant care and food production.
